Transporting temperature-sensitive medicines demands qualified cold-chain containers, Appropriate refrigerants, and maintained temperature monitoring. Select an express service where possible, pre-cool gel packs, and include a data logger in the carton to verify that medical drugs stayed within their labeled temperature range.
Fragile glass vials of pharmaceutical goods must be packed in compartmental inserts with surrounding foam. Place trays inside a sturdy shipping box and block and brace with void-fill so nothing moves. For moisture-sensitive medical drugs, pair this with moisture-barrier inner bags and desiccants.
International shipments of medical drugs typically demand a detailed commercial invoice, packing list, and any permits required by the importing country. Several markets also Expect Certificates of Analysis, proof of GDP-compliant handling, and clear temperature instructions for cold-chain medicines. Verify requirements with your customs broker before shipping.
For moisture-sensitive pharmaceutical goods, select high-barrier bags plus desiccant sachets inside the packaging. Close cartons tightly, avoid damaged boxes, and Choose transport options that minimize exposure to rain and high humidity, such as covered docks and climate-controlled linehaul for medical drugs.
High-value medical drugs generally need enhanced cargo insurance that covers temperature excursions, breakage, and theft. Coordinate with an insurer familiar with pharmaceutical goods, Declare the full replacement value, and store temperature and handling records so claims can be processed efficiently if something goes wrong.
Pharmaceuticals require temperature-controlled environments during transport to maintain efficacy. It’s crucial to use insulated containers and monitor temperature throughout the journey. Additionally, proper stowage to prevent damage and ensure stability is essential.
Shipping pharmaceuticals requires specific documentation including a commercial invoice, packing list, bill of lading, and any necessary import permits or certificates from health authorities in Taiwan. Compliance with both Turkish and Taiwanese regulations is essential for customs clearance.
